[ detailed description ] embodiments
The invention will be described in detail with reference to the drawings and specific embodiments, wherein the exemplary embodiments and the description are only for the purpose of explanation, but not for the purpose of limitation.
As shown in fig. 1-3, the portable charging box for a convenient-to-use travel wireless interpreter in the present embodiment comprises a charging storage box body, the charging storage box body comprises a bottom box 1 and a box cover 4, and the box cover 4 is hinged on the bottom box 1;
a partition plate 9 is arranged on the right side in the bottom box 1, and divides the bottom box 1 into a charging chamber 3 and a containing chamber 10; the charging chamber 3 is rectangular, and a charging assembly is assembled in the charging chamber 3, wherein the charging assembly comprises a power interface 19, a power switch 2, a rectifier module 20, a circuit board assembly and a plurality of charging slot positions 13; the power interface 19 is electrically connected to the rectifier module 20 through the power switch 2, and the rectifier module 20 is electrically connected to the circuit board assembly; wherein, the circuit board assembly is provided with a plurality of positive spring pin jacks 22 and negative spring pin jacks 23; wherein, a positive spring pin and a negative spring pin which are connected with the equipment are arranged in each charging slot position 13; wherein, the positive spring needle in the charging slot position 13 is assembled with the positive spring needle jack 22, the negative spring needle in the charging slot position 13 is assembled with the negative spring needle jack 23, and the positive spring needle and the negative spring needle are electrically connected with the circuit board assembly; the outer side wall of the bottom case 1 is also provided with a heat dissipation hole 15 communicated with the charging chamber 3, and a heat dissipation fan electrically connected with the rectifier module 20 is assembled in the heat dissipation hole 15; the top of the inner wall of the box cover 4 is provided with four hooks 6; a plurality of elastic bands 7 are arranged between the left side and the right side in the box cover 4, and plastic buckles are arranged between the elastic bands 7; the plastic eye-splice in the design is the same as the eye-splice of the common bag belt. The edge of the inner bottom of the box cover 4 is hinged with a density board 8, the shape of the density board 8 is rectangular, and the size of the density board 8 is matched with the top end opening of the bottom box 1.
When the rectifier module is used, 220V alternating current can be accessed through the power interface 19, the power switch 2 is turned on, and the 220V alternating current is converted into 5V direct current through the rectifier module 20; the explaining device 18 can be directly placed in the charging slot position 13 (namely, the charging terminals of the explaining device 18 are respectively connected with the positive spring pin and the negative spring pin), so that charging can be realized, a charging wire does not need to be additionally connected, and the charging is convenient and quick; and the situation that the charging wires are wound together when a plurality of the explanation devices 18 are charged can be avoided.
The charging slot 13 is more convenient, simple, quick and easy to use compared with a USB jack, and can be directly inserted into the charging slot 13 to be charged without alignment;
the equipment inserting direction of the charging slot position 13 is provided with an obvious mark, the front and the back adopt a bright design and a matte design, and a front letter front is written on the slot position, so that the front and the back positions can be conveniently identified;
meanwhile, the explaining device 18 displays the charging and full-charging states by a traffic light, so that the charging state can be conveniently judged;
in the application, the containing chamber 10 is further separated from the bottom box 1, so that a user can place daily work accessories or other sundries in the containing chamber 10, the arrangement and collection of articles are facilitated, and the overall layout is regular and attractive.
Meanwhile, the outer side wall of the bottom case 1 is also provided with a heat dissipation hole 15 communicated with the charging chamber 3, and the heat dissipation hole 15 is provided with a heat dissipation fan; that is, the charging box can effectively dissipate the heat accumulated in the charging chamber 3 through the cooling fan, so as to ensure the normal operation of the charging box.
Meanwhile, a plurality of hooks 6 are arranged at the inner side of the box cover 4 close to the outer side, and an elastic band 7 is arranged in the middle; that is, the user can detach the hanging rope 14 from the explaining device 18, and then hang one end of the hanging rope 14 on the hook 6, the other end of the hanging rope 14 extends to the bottom of the box cover 4, and the hanging rope 14 at the middle position is attached to the inner wall of the box cover through the elastic band 7. The condition that the hanging rope 14 is thrown in disorder and wound seriously is avoided, and the hanging rope 14 is placed neatly, so that the whole vision is attractive. Further, a box buckle 17 is installed between the bottom box 1 and the box cover 4.
Further, for convenience of carrying, a handle 12 is arranged in the middle of the right side surface of the bottom case 1. After the bottom case 1 and the case cover 4 are locked by the case buckle 17, the user can directly lift the charging case by the handle 12, which is very convenient.

Further, the right end edge of the top surface of the containing chamber 10 is hinged with a containing chamber cover plate 11 matched with the containing chamber 10 in size, a pull ring 5 with a round hole shape is arranged in the middle of the containing chamber cover plate 11, and frame-shaped positive and negative magnets are correspondingly arranged on the periphery of the bottom surface of the containing chamber cover plate 11 and the periphery of the top end of the containing chamber 10. In the design, a partition plate 9 is arranged on the right side in the bottom box 1 to divide the bottom box 1 into a charging chamber 3 and a containing chamber 10; the charging chamber 33 is rectangular, and the storage chamber 10 is rectangular; a containing chamber cover plate 11 is hinged on the containing chamber 10, a pull ring 5 is arranged in the middle of the containing chamber cover plate 11, and the objects in the containing chamber 10 can be conveniently observed through a hole in the pull ring 5; meanwhile, the design of the pull ring 5 can facilitate the opening of the containing chamber cover plate 11 by a user. Meanwhile, the periphery of the bottom surface of the storage chamber cover plate 11 and the periphery of the top end of the storage chamber 10 are correspondingly provided with frame-shaped positive and negative magnets. Then, when the storage chamber cover 11 is closed in the storage chamber 10, the mutual magnetic attraction can be realized through the positive and negative magnets in the frame shape, the opening and closing are facilitated, even if the whole box body is turned over, the storage chamber cover 11 faces downwards, and the storage chamber cover 11 cannot be opened due to the magnetic attraction, so that the effect of protecting the objects in the storage chamber 10 can be achieved.
Further, the density board 8 is wrapped with flannelette. The flannelette protects the equipment of the bottom case 1, can cover the hooks 6 and the elastic bands 7 in the case cover 4, and the whole body can be seen cleanly and tidily after being stored.
Further, an opening 81 is formed in the middle of the upper end of the density plate 8. Likewise, opening 81 facilitates viewing of the contents of case lid 4; and the density board 8 is convenient to open, and the function of carrying the handle is achieved.
Furthermore, a screen 16 is also arranged outside the heat dissipation hole 15. The partition net 16 prevents foreign matters from entering the charging chamber 3, and functions to protect the charging box.
Further, the circuit board assembly comprises 8 PCB circuit boards 21, and each PCB circuit board 21 is provided with a VCC end, a GND end, 5 positive spring pin jacks 22 electrically connected with the VCC end, and 5 negative spring pin jacks 23 electrically connected with the GND end; the positive output end of the rectifier module 20 is electrically connected to the VCC terminal on each PCB 21, and the negative output end of the rectifier module 20 is electrically connected to the GND terminal on each PCB 21. In the embodiment, 220V alternating current is controlled to be switched on and off through the power switch 2, input voltage is provided for the rectifier module 20, the rectifier module 20 converts 5V regulated voltage, and the maximum 40A current supplies power to the whole charging system, wherein 5 charging slots 13 can be supplied with power on one PCB 21, the current of each charging slot 13 is 220mA, and as the whole box has 40 charging slots 13, 8 identical PCB 21 are connected in parallel to supply power to 40 slots.
Reference may be made to fig. 3, wherein P1 through TP10 are pogo pin sockets in the same PCB board 21, wherein TP1 through TP5 are 5V positive pogo pin sockets 22, and TP6 through TP10 are 0V negative pogo pin sockets 23. 5V power is supplied to the VCC terminal of P1 through rectifier module 20(220V AC input, 5V DC output) and then 5V DC is supplied to each of the pogo pin sockets TP1 through TP5 to provide voltage to the pogo pin sockets on each board to charge the device.
